This video details the process of reloading 6.5 Creedmoor ammunition using 140-grain Hornady Match BTHP bullets with two different powders: IMR 4451 and Reloder 22. The instructor, with apparent expertise in reloading and ballistics, systematically tests various charge weights, providing velocity and group size data. Key takeaways include the impact of brass annealing on standard deviation and the performance characteristics of each powder with the tested bullet, highlighting accuracy and velocity trade-offs.
